Party affiliation:

Democrat

Social media accounts:
Facebook.com/Stan Wheeler for Maine Senate; wheelerformaine.mainecandidates.com/

Occupation:
Retired director of communications, Franklin County E-911; chaplain for Farmington Fire Department Center

Education:
B.S Rochester Institute of Technology; MDiv. Bangor Theological Seminary

Community Organizations:
President of the board, Central Maine Media Alliance; president of the board, Fairbanks School Neighborhood Association; coordinator of the Old South Church community lunches; Farmington Fire Department chaplain

Personal information (hobbies, etc.):
I love to fish and hike, and play with my 3-year-old German Shepherd. I love to cook, and I host a cooking show on Mt. Blue TV. I enjoy traveling with my wife and spending time with my family and friends.

Family status:
Married

Years in the Legislature:

None

Committee assignments (if elected):
Agriculture, Conservation and Forestry, Education and Cultural Affairs, Criminal Justice and Public Safety

Q&A

Define what “success” would look like if you are elected to serve your district.
Success will be continued full funding for public education and full protection of women’s reproductive rights, as well as continuing assurance that all citizens enjoy full civil rights protections, including the right to marry who they wish. Success will also mean an increase in the public’s trust in government.

Characterize your view on public access to governmental business.
I believe that all government business should be transparent
